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I use these streaming apps on multiple devices?

Yes, most of these streaming apps offer multi-device support, allowing you to access your favorite content on smartphones, tablets, smart TVs, and more. However, it’s always a good idea to check the app’s official website for specific device compatibility information.

2. Are these streaming apps available globally?

While some streaming apps have a global reach, there are certain regional restrictions due to licensing agreements. It’s important to verify the availability of your desired app in your region before subscribing or downloading.

3. Can I watch content offline with these apps?

Several streaming apps, such as ShowMax and Streamipedia, allow you to download movies and TV episodes for offline viewing. This feature comes in handy when you’re traveling or don’t have a stable internet connection.

4. Are these streaming apps free or do they require a subscription?

While some apps offer free content with occasional ad interruptions, many of them operate on a subscription-based model. The subscription fees vary depending on the app and the package you choose. However, some apps also offer free trial periods for you to test their services before committing.

5. Can I cancel my subscription anytime?

Yes, most streaming apps allow you to cancel your subscription at any time without any penalties. You can usually manage your subscription settings directly within the app or through the app’s official website.

6. Do these streaming apps support high-definition (HD) or 4K streaming?

Yes, the majority of these streaming apps support HD or even 4K streaming, provided you have a compatible device and a stable internet connection. However, please note that higher quality streaming may require higher internet bandwidth.

7. Can I create multiple profiles within these streaming apps?

Yes, most streaming apps allow you to create multiple profiles within a single account. This feature comes in handy when multiple users with different preferences share the same app. Each profile can have its personalized recommendations and watch history.

8. How frequently is the content updated on these streaming apps?

The content update frequency varies depending on the app and the licensing agreements with content providers. However, popular streaming apps typically add new movies, TV shows, and other content on a regular basis to keep their library fresh and exciting.

9. Can I stream live sports events using these apps?

While some streaming apps offer live TV channels that may include sports events, dedicated sports streaming platforms might be a better option if you’re primarily interested in live sports coverage. However, it’s always worth checking the available channels and offerings of the app in question.

10. Can I share my account with friends or family?

Sharing your account depends on the terms and conditions of each streaming app. Some apps allow simultaneous streaming on multiple devices, while others restrict the number of devices or simultaneous streams per account. Make sure to review the app’s policies before sharing your account with others.

11. Are parental controls available on these streaming apps?

Yes, many streaming apps provide parental control features to help you regulate the content accessible to children. These controls allow you to set age restrictions, block certain content, and create child-friendly profiles.

12. Can I connect my streaming app to my smart TV?

Absolutely! Most streaming apps are compatible with smart TVs, including popular brands like Samsung, LG, Sony, and more. You can either download the app directly from your TV’s app store or use built-in features like screen mirroring or casting to enjoy your favorite content on the big screen.

13. What are the recommended internet connection speeds for smooth streaming?

The recommended internet connection speeds for smooth streaming vary depending on the streaming quality you desire. For standard definition (SD) streaming, a minimum speed of 3 Mbps is usually sufficient. However, for HD or 4K streaming, you’ll need higher speeds, such as 5-25 Mbps or more, to ensure uninterrupted playback.
